Preserving Evidence

Every year, dozens of people are killed in train accidents in NYC, and hundreds more suffer injuries that have devastating consequences for the immediate and long-term. It is important to retain a NYC train accident attorney immediately to preserve evidence and start an investigation in cases that involve mass transportation. The sooner you begin the process the more likely it will be to discover crucial information including the reason of the accident as well as the responsible parties.

In the beginning of an investigation, a skilled train accident lawyer will take photos of the scene from a variety of angles and capture other important visual evidence. This evidence can be used to reconstruct the incident and is crucial to know what transpired. The lawyer will also take photos of any vehicle damage and obtain maintenance records. They will also collect information from the big truck crash attorney accident Lawyer (www.question-ksa.com)'s electronic controls modules (ECMs) or "black boxes" that record vital information before, during and after the collision.

The attorney will also interview witnesses as soon as they can in order to keep their statements. In many instances, memories fade over time, and witness testimony obtained shortly after an accident could be more persuasive than statements made days or weeks later. A lawyer who is knowledgeable in the law will also preserve physical evidence, such as torn clothes or damaged personal belongings. This can be useful in proving the severity and impact of the incident on the victim.

The most common cause for train accidents is negligence. Negligence occurs when a person fails, under the circumstances, to exercise reasonable care to prevent injury to others. This could include reckless acts like speeding or driving while drunk or making simple errors, such as not checking for the signal for crossing or examining the tracks for obstructions before running over them.

A successful personal injury claim typically will require proof that the defendant acted negligently. Your lawyer can analyze the facts of your case to determine what evidence to collect, and how to present it in the court to convince the jury of your case's merits.
